Shibuya Fukuras is a landmark mixed-use complex completed in 2019 in Tokyo's vibrant Shibuya district. This sophisticated development seamlessly integrates commercial facilities, transportation infrastructure, and office spaces, serving as a vital hub for the bustling neighborhood. Designed through a collaborative effort by renowned architectural firms including Tsukuba Architects Studio, Nikken Sekkei, and Shimizu Corporation, the building exemplifies contemporary Japanese architecture. Its innovative design thoughtfully addresses urban connectivity while maintaining aesthetic excellence, making it an essential case study for architecture enthusiasts interested in modern Japanese urban development and integrated mixed-use design.
